Depending on the operating system of the computers you are moving from and to, transferring everything is not always straightforward.
Moving from one operating system to the same operating system on a different computer or on a different hard drive partition is the easiest type of transfer. One does not have to worry about compatibility issues for computer settings in this case. If you want your files transferred to a computer with the same operating system, you can easily transfer all drivers, user settings, and configurations. However, if you are transferring to a computer with a different operating system, some of the configurations and settings may be difficult or impossible to transfer over. Some computer owners want to save all of their programs from their old computer. Often there are newer versions of these programs offered, but computer owners tend to feel attached to the programs they have already purchased. If the owner has all of the original CDs and registration keys, this will not be a problem. We can reinstall programs from original CDs and set up the programs like they were on the old computer or old drive. Sometimes, however, owners forget where they placed the original CDs or registration keys. If the program has been registered online, customer service may be able to help identify the owner and may allow the program to be reinstalled on another computer. More often than not, owners have lost the CDs and registration keys and in this case, the owner may need to repurchase the software for the new computer.
